When it comes to maintaining and troubleshooting blood gas analyzers, a proficient technician knows the importance of following a systematic approach, especially when dealing with control parameters that are out of range. You may ask yourself, what’s the first step here? Is it cleaning the electrode or maybe replacing the buffer solutions? While those may seem like good guesses, the essential first step is verifying the control data.

You know what? This makes perfect sense. By first checking if the control solutions are still valid, properly stored, and appropriately dated, you fast-track the troubleshooting process. It’s like checking the ingredients in your pantry before whipping up dinner—better safe than sorry, right?

Now, let's break it down a bit. When the analyzer operates correctly but shows out-of-range values, you have to ensure those control materials aren’t the culprits. You don't want to mistakenly presume that your machine is acting up when it’s actually a simple mix-up with expired control solutions or mishandled samples. So, think of verifying control data as the “pre-check”—analyzing the ingredients before cooking up a solution.

For starters, look closely at the control solutions used. Their shelf life matters! If they’re past their prime, it’s time to replace them. They also need to be stored correctly to maintain their integrity. Checking all of these beforehand allows you to rule out any quality issues that might be skewing your results. Once you’ve verified the control data, and it checks out, then it’s a good idea to think about tasks like cleaning the PO2 electrode or diving into more complex cleaning of the sample path.
